これは、Ubuntu Online、Fedora Online、Windows オンライン エミュレーター、または MAC OS オンライン エミュレーターなどの複数の無料オンライン ワークステーションの 1 つを使用して、OnWorks 無料ホスティング プロバイダーで実行できるコマンド make_strings です。
プログラム:
NAME
make_strings - Objective-C ファイルからローカライズ可能な文字列のリストを作成するツール
SYNOPSIS
メイクストリングス [ - 助けて] [-詳細] [--積極的なインポート] [-- アグレッシブマッチ] [- 攻撃的-
削除します] [-L 言語] ファイル.[hmc...]
DESCRIPTION
メイクストリングス Objective-C ファイルを解析し、ローカライズ可能な文字列のリストを作成します。それなら
新しいものを作成する .strings ファイルを作成するか、文字列を既存の文字列とマージします .strings ファイル。その
古い文字列と新しい文字列を照合するときはかなりインテリジェントであり、 .strings ファイル
翻訳者にとっては扱いやすい(はずである)。
メイクストリングス 次のオプションを受け入れます。
OPTIONS
- 助けて 利用可能なオプションの短いリストを出力します。
-詳細
処理中に追加情報を出力します。
-L 言語
処理する言語を指定します。複数 -L オプションまたは複数のオプションが受け入れられます
言語 1つに定義されている -L フラグ。
--aggressive-import
有効にする -- アグレッシブマッチ そして、次のような「ダミー」エントリを自動的に削除します。
インポートによって追加されました .strings によって作成されていないファイル メイクストリングス プログラム。
このオプションは次の場合に適しています。 メイクストリングス 初めて実行され、
既存の .strings かなり正確な翻訳を含むファイル。
-- アグレッシブマッチ
このオプションは メイクストリングス 一致するキーには一致がある必要があると想定します
翻訳。これにより多くの作業を節約できますが、エラーのリスクが高まります。
翻訳。
--aggressive-remove
廃止された文字列/キーを削除します。
例
make_strings -L "英語 スウェーデン語 ロシア語" *.[hm]
onworks.net サービスを使用してオンラインで make_strings を使用する